Lot 197
(HAGADAH)

Hagadah shel Pessach. Instructions in Judeo-German printed in Wayber-taytsch type

Blank spaces beneath illustration captions ff. (11, of 18), lacking title, ff.2-6 & 18. Browned, stained in places, neat marginal repairs. Modern maroon morocco-backed marbled boards. Folio cf. Vinograd, Prague 764; Yudlov 125; Yaari 78

(Prague: n.p. 1713) ?

Est: $2,500 - $3,000
A Hagadah fragment with Prague style typography. Yudlov records this apparent edition complete with copper-plate illustrations. This copy has the captions for the traditional Venice-style copper plate Hagadah illustrations, but with blank spaces where the plates would have been placed. This. therefore, would seem to be a mutant copy, with the plates erroneously or otherwise omitted
